FAU 90-degree Bend
A special fiber optic array technology enables large-angle bending up to 90 degrees. It reduces fiber height by 50%, for example, reducing the height of the fiber optic array unit (FAU) used in data center transceivers to less than 4 mm, while simultaneously increasing fiber density by 35% within a given width, such as reducing the width of a 72-core FAU to less than 9 mm. This technology offers advantages such as high core-to-core spacing tolerance and the ability to accommodate a large number of channels, enabling low-profile fiber coupling to chips.
